One of the tourist attractions of Mol is undoubtedly the Zilvermeer. But did you know that this popular body of water was also a sand extraction pit in the nineteenth century? In 1910, extraction stopped and from 1930, beach tourism developed around the pit. Since 1959, it has officially been a provincial domain where tens of thousands of visitors come every year.
